📖 The Story
Siketa Meats is more than just a butcher; it’s a Geelong institution. When I walked in, the queue was out the door - always a sign you’re in for something special. The displays were immaculate, packed with an incredible variety of meats, from premium cuts to European specialties. The energy in the shop was infectious, and a big part of that was Boris, who helped me. He was knowledgeable, full of energy, and clearly proud of the butcher’s heritage. Siketa specializes in salamis, sausages, and even salt-dried meats - something I haven’t seen at many other butchers!

🛒 What I Picked Up
For this braai, I went all out - Scotch fillet, T-bone steaks, chicken skewers, and some delicious cevapcici sausages. The Scotch fillet had a fantastic marbling, the T-bones promised bold flavor, and the chicken skewers were ready to shine. The cevapcici - Balkan-style sausages -were the perfect unique touch that got me excited to fire up the coals.
🔥 The Braai Test
The Scotch fillet was tender and flavorful, while the T-bone gave that classic, satisfying bite. The chicken skewers came out juicy and perfectly charred.
